Alipur - Gaurihar, Chhatarpur
Alipur is a village situated in the Gaurihar tehsil of Chhatarpur district, Madhya Pradesh. It is located approximately 4 km from the tehsil headquarters in Gaurihar and around 100 km from the district headquarters in Chhatarpur. Alipur village is a designated Gram Panchayat.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Alipur is 457420. The village covers a total geographical area of 536.8 hectares and falls under the 471516 pincode. Barigarh is the nearest town.
Alipur village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Chandla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Khajuraho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Alipur
As per Census 2011, Alipur village has a total population of 1,201 people, consisting of 642 males and 559 females. The village has 281 households and a sex ratio of 870 females per 1,000 males. There are 201 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 748 literate and 453 illiterate residents. Additionally, 572 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Alipur are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 1,201 | 642 | 559 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 201 | 118 | 83 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 572 | 318 | 254 |
| Literate Population | 748 | 434 | 314 |
| Illiterate Population | 453 | 208 | 245 |

Transport and Connectivity of Alipur
Alipur is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ared van services. Alipur has a railway station.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within <5 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within <5 km |
| Railway Station | Yes | Available within village |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. the road distance from Chhatarpur to Alipur is about 100 km, with the usual travel time around ~2.9 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
